Output 95604fff0f4ca86db6e0fa6dd34e5b34e2fbea9a8d353444dee4ebf01bb8776e:0

value
5172448
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2aaf271a17873e581f56730e56b969bff397d387 OP_EQUALVERIFY OP_CHECKSIG
address
14thCtCXAqxfa9ff5MDgVZR8EibLV3zPHb
transaction
95604fff0f4ca86db6e0fa6dd34e5b34e2fbea9a8d353444dee4ebf01bb8776e
spent
true